The Defense Health Agency is conducting market research to identify qualified sources capable of providing specialized healthcare environmental cleaning and linen services across multiple locations in Germany. The scope of work involves management activities such as planning, scheduling, cost accounting, and performance management, alongside direct cleaning and linen operations. Primary performance locations include the Landstuhl Regional Medical Center and its outlying clinics, the Medical Department Activity Bavaria health, dental, and veterinary clinics, and the Rhine Ordinance Medical Center in Weilerbach.
This federal opportunity is classified under NAICS 561720 for Janitorial Services and PSC Q901 for Healthcare Environmental Cleaning. The government has scheduled tentative site visits for July 21, 2026, at the Landstuhl and Rhine Ordinance locations, and July 23, 2026, for the Bavaria clinics. Point of contact Hyun Townsley is overseeing the inquiry process for this notice, which includes four attachments: two versions of a sources sought questionnaire, a draft performance work statement, and a document detailing total square meters by region.
Interested parties must submit a response of no more than 10 pages in English by the deadline of March 27, 2026. Submissions must include the completed questionnaire to demonstrate the capability to meet certification requirements and high-quality standards. This sources sought notice, identified by solicitation number HT9406-26-LRMC, is issued solely for information and planning purposes to assist the Defense Health Agency in determining its acquisition strategy.
